Check out the Kingsford Kaddy Charcoal Bin Review. You will see how 20lb bags and 15lb bags fit. I show how to cut the bag in order for it to store and pour. Here's some details on the Kaddy:
-Made of recycled polypropylene with a black finish.
-High density polyethylene lid
-Heavy duty handle for easy carrying and use.
-Polished black finish.
-8 gallon capacity, can hold 23lbs of charcoal.
-Weatherproof design.

Thank you very much for the video. It was very helpful. May I add that the directions on Kaddy say "Replace Lid with Bag Gripper piece INSIDE the open bag". The bag gripper is the piece that is at the front of the Kaddy below the flip top. This keeps the bag in place. It also enables the charcoal to glide smoothly from the blue plastic lid into the grill or starter. I love that it is made in the USA. I just purchased it at Lowes for $11.98 plus tax. I also discovered through KZbin that Weber makes "Lighter Cubes" that allows you to put the charcoal directly into the grill to light the charcoal. Home Depot sells a box of 24 cubes for a little over $3 (have not check Lowes yet). The picture shows that you put 2 cubes on the coals and light the coals. The directions say: 1. Place 2-3 cubes in center of charcoal grate. 2. Pile briquets in a pyramid fashion on top of the lighter cubes with corner of cube showing. 3. Ignite cubes, leaving grill lid off. 4. Let charcoal burn 20 to 30 minutes until ashed over before cooking. This is great news for RVers. Less things to carry!
